2015 Alfa Romeo 4C Spider FIRST LOOK

When I first took the wheel of the all-new Alfa Romeo 4C last summer, its candid no-nonsense approach to sports car driving was as refreshing as it was surprising.  This is a car, after all, that disposes with the notion of power steering.  And now to expand the 4C offerings, an open-air Spider debuts for the 2015 model year.

2015 Alfa Romeo 4C SpiderHandcrafted in Italy in a process that takes 6 weeks to produce a single car, the Spider features a removable canvas top that can be folded and stowed in the rear storage space or an optional carbon fiber hard top roof that must stay behind.  Looking to drop weight wherever possible, the svelte 4C Spider adds even more carbon fiber to a car already rich with it; to the windshield surround, trimming the vents, around the center-mounted exhaust and even the car’s rear “halo,” if desired. Thanks to the carbon fiber monocoque body’s inherent rigidity – three times stronger than steel – engineers were able to minimize structural differences between the Spider and the Coupe.

The mid-mounted 1750 cc 4-cylinder turbocharged engine plays the sounds of generating 237 horsepower and 258 pound feet of torque through one of 3 available exhaust systems including an all-new Akrapovic dual-mode system for the most ardent motorsports enthusiasts.  A Track package is also available with uprated shocks, larger sway bars, Pirelli AR Racing tires and other interior enhancements.
